## Artifact Signing — Docwrench

Docwrench is our documentation linter. Its release artifacts are signed like any other Marlport binary — no exceptions for "just docs tooling."

Quick facts:

- Builds run on the Ferrow pipeline, tags only.
- The signed tarball lands in the Ashgate registry.
- Verify locally with `docwrench verify` before promoting.
- Unsigned builds will not install on shared runners.

New joiners: you'll need the team signing key to cut a release. It is provided below.

signing key of bagap-yawep = bky13_TbfT6ZMUoGJo2

Ticket: TMPL-412 — Signature check failing on render workers

Since the Larkspur template cache update, worker pods at Ostermile reject precompiled bundles with a signature mismatch, forcing slow uncached renders and doubling p95 latency. The bundles were signed with the rotated key but workers still pin the old one. Update the trust store with the key below.

release key, fahaf-bajof: bky3_Xam

Changed defaults in Splitfork, our assignment service. Bucketing now uses sticky hashing per account instead of per session, and the holdout slice grew from 2% to 5%. Callers relying on session-level reassignment must opt in explicitly. Review the diff against the new baseline; the updated default configuration is listed below.

config for tagep-kajof:
[casir]
port = 6379
region = south-1
host = casir.paliqdyn.example
team = tamax
timeout_ms = 250
retries = 2

Test plan: Quellhorn queue-depth autoscaler. Verify scale-up at depth > 500 sustained 30s, scale-down after 5m idle. Inject synthetic backlog via the loadgen harness; confirm no flapping across three cycles. Assert replica count capped at 12. Metrics scraped from the staging gateway; compare against the fixture baselines in the repo. Reviewer: run the harness against staging only. Authenticate the harness with the bearer token provided below.

session JWT of yawep-yawep = eyJhbGciOiJIUzI1NiIsInR5cCI6IkpXVCJ9.eyJzdWIiOiI3pWF3_In0.aXYsHiog

Handover: Brightloom plugin build → Kilnworks hermetic system. Hey — plugin authors will need pinned toolchains now; no more ambient system deps. The migration script handles most manifests, but custom codegen steps must declare inputs explicitly or builds fail. I've sealed the signing material in the migration vault; unseal it with the recovery passphrase below.

vault phrase of bagap-yajof = fenath-druwyn